A new sort of ultraviolet light that may be safe for individuals took much less than five minutes to reduce the level of interior airborne microorganisms by more than 98%, a joint research study by researchers at Columbia College Vagelos University of Physicians and Surgeons and in the U.K. has actually found. Also as microorganisms continued to be sprayed right into the room, the level stayed extremely reduced as lengthy as the lights were on.


However previously these research studies had actually just been performed in small speculative chambers, not in full-sized spaces resembling real-world conditions. In the current research, researchers at the University of St. Andrews, University of Dundee, University of Leeds, and Columbia College examined the efficacy of far-UVC light in a large room-sized chamber with the exact same air flow price as a regular home or office (concerning three air changes per hour).


The effectiveness of different strategies to reducing indoor virus levels is typically determined in regards to comparable air changes per hour. In this study, far-UVC lamps produced the matching of 184 equal air exchanges per hour. This goes beyond any various other technique to decontaminating occupied interior rooms, where 5 to 20 equal air adjustments per hour is the most effective that can be attained almost.

The main parameters of UV-C disinfection are wavelength, dose, loved one moisture, and temperature level. There is no agreement regarding their optimal worths, but, in basic, light at a high dose and a spectrum of wavelengths containing 260 nm is liked in a setting at space temperature with low family member humidity. This light can be created by mercury-vapour, light-emitting diode (LED), pulsed-xenon, or excimer lights.


There are wellness and safety risks linked with the UV-C innovation when used in the proximity of individuals. UV-C sanitation systems have promising attributes and the possible to improve in the future. Explanations bordering the different specifications influencing the innovations' effectiveness in hospital atmosphere are required. For that reason UV-C disinfection must presently be thought about for low-level as opposed to high-level sanitation.


One more application arose in 1910 when UV light was utilized to decontaminate water. The technology was not very trustworthy at the time and it took official website further technical growths prior to UV water sanitation became popular once again in the 1950s [ 2] Nowadays, UV light is made use of for water, air, food, surface area, and clinical equipment disinfection.
